For those of you following the global Internet Governance Forum (IGF) process, please consider participating in this call for issues. The
idea behind it is to help the MAG to decide on the main issues that the Internet community wants to focus this year discussions around, to better structure the program of the event for this year, as well as help guide the deliberations for intersessional work
through the Best Practices Forums, the Dynamic Coalitions, etc. Hope you can contribute to this, even if you are not planning to attend the event. The more people that contributes and shares what are the issues that affect their work or that they see as challenges
for the development of the Internet, the better chances we have that the outcomes of the discussions are practical and actionable. After this, the call for workshops/sessions will follow and the MAG will work on structure a program that -hopefully- will balance the
workshops/session that address the issues raised by the community. I look forward to active participation form the Asia Pacific Technical Community.
The call for issues is looking at contributions around the following categories but are also allowed to suggest new categorizations.
